Energy Efficiency
40, Dorset Mews has an Energy Performance Rating (EPC) of C. This is based on the most recent assessment, dated 23 Feb 2022.
The property is not connected to mains gas and has fully double glazed windows. It is heated using Electric storage heaters.
Sold Prices
According to HM Land Registry, 40, Dorset Mews was last sold on 24th July 1997 for £69,000 and was recorded as a leasehold flat.
The property has had 2 sales since 1995.
